Brick Bass Tab Written by Ben Folds Performed on the Album "Whatever and Amen" By Ben Folds Five (Guitar chords under the basslines)
The beginning of the verse, there's no bass. Eventually, he comes in with his contrabass and plays a quiet little riff.
1st Verse: 6 AM, day after Christmas.... D Dsus2 G6sus2(x3) Bm7 E7sus4 E7 Esus4
2nd verse: And I am....dumb. G|----------------------| D|---------5lr----------| A|--5lr-----------------| E|----------------------| Same as above chords.
It sounds best if you have a noise gate and crank it up all the way to cut off most of the attack, so it sounds like the contrabass fading in.
The verse line comes in a bit after. It's easy, also. I go downtown to her apartment.... G|--------------------------------------| D|--------------------------------------| A|-5---5---5---5----------------------| E|--------------------3---3---3---3---| Same verse chords.
You may want to play the G (third fret on the E String) an ocatve higher
( fifth fret on the D String) , it's hard to tell what he's playing.
The prechorus goes like this.
And we drive Now that I have found someone I'm feelin' more alone than I ever have before G|-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------|
D|------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------|
A|--2-2-2-------------2-2-2-----------------5--5--5---------------2-2-2---------------------------|
E|-----------3-3-3-------------3-3-3--------------------3--3--3-------------0-0-0-0-0-0-0-0-0--|
Bm7 G6sus Bm7 G6sus D G6sus Bm7 E7
The chorus is just a simple G-A-D progression.
She's a brick and I'm drowning slowly.... G|--------------------------------------------| D|--------------------------------------------| A|--------------------------5-5-5-5---------| E|--3-3-3-3---5-5-5-5---------------------| G A Dmaj9
The bridge is fairly easy, as well. As weeks went by, it showed that she was not fine. G|----------------------------------------------------------------------|
D|----------------------------------------------------------------------|
A|---------------------------------------------5-5-5-5-5-5-5-5-5---| E|--0-0-0-0-0-0-0-0--3-3-3-3-3-3-3-3-3-------------------------| E7 G6sus D
